ABSTRACT The attention of contemporary planners to environmental factors and increasing awareness and communication of man with his surrounding environment has increased the layers and defining factors of design and planning concepts. In such a way, a common problem with the issue of environmental capabilities to respond was put in front of the planners. The collection of ideas presented in this era was in the form of responsive planning, focusing on the maximum use of environmental capabilities. The necessity of the emergence of a comprehensive discourse to overcome the plurality of factors, definitions and design methods in the environmental fields has been given less attention. Based on this, the current research aims to organize the leading theories in this field in a targeted manner and seeks to improve them based on their synergy. The structural question of this research is the meanings, examples and meaningful contexts of flexibility in various aspects and scales of urban planning. The research method used is qualitative thematic analysis with the help of artificial intelligence in MAXQDA software in a 6-step processing process. The important application of this research is to structure the minds of the planners of this field to reduce the scattered and interdisciplinary problems of the resources. The results of this research revealed dimensions such as identification and recognizability, diversity and changeability, adaptability and expandability, distribution, separation and continuity, organization and compatibility in the field of flexibility and related to the corresponding parts in urban planning   Extended Abstract Introduction Responsiveness-based design and planning emphasizing the maximum use of environmental capacities to meet users' needs implicitly cause a targeted improvement of environmental quality. Probability density functions of the involved random variables are essential for the reliability-based design of offshore structures. The objective of present research was the derivation of probability density function (PDF) for the local joint flexibility (LJF) factor, fLJF, in two-planar tubular DK-joints commonly found in jacket-type offshore structures. A total of 162 finite element (FE) analyses were carried out on 81 FE models of DK-joints subjected to two types of axial loading. Generated FE models were validated using available experimental data, FE results, and design formulas. Based on the results of parametric FE study, a sample database was prepared for the fLJF values and density histograms were generated for respective samples based on the Freedman-Diaconis rule. Nine theoretical PDFs were fitted to the developed histograms and the maximum likelihood (ML) method was applied to evaluate the parameters of fitted PDFs. In each case, the Kolmogorov-Smirnov and chi-squared tests were used to evaluate the goodness of fit. Finally, the Inverse Gaussian model was proposed as the governing probability distribution function for the fLJF. After substituting the values of estimated parameters, two fully defined PDFs were presented for the fLJF in tubular DK-joints subjected to two types of axial loading.

Contracts can be set in one of the two following ways: rigid or flexible. The first type focuses to foresee all the rights and obligations of both of the parties only through attaching importance to legal relations. The drawback of such contracts is their lack of adaptability with the possible future changes in the conditions which can lead to loosing opportunities. On the other hand, flexible contracts, especially used in long-term business relations, are adaptive to possible future changes as they establish balance among interpersonal, legal, and exchange relations. flexibility is a beneficial skill that can be used when changes arise. According to surveys rigid contracts were favored in the past while flexible ones, due to their ability to keep pace with an accelerated world, are popular today. By its descriptive-analytic approach, the present research attempts to introduce flexible contracts and their benefits, and also the ways through which it is possible to make contracts flexible and keep their stability at the same time under the two headings of collaboration and visualisation.

Deciding on the financing and composition of capital structure in Corporates depends on a variety of factors. Several studies have shown that financial flexibility is the most important factor affecting capital structure and corporate financing decisions. The main objective of the research is to measure the financial flexibility of Corporates accepted in Tehran Securities Exchange (in accordance with the corporate environment and conditions). Therefore, according to the purpose of the research, in the first Step, based on the conceptual and theoretical framework derived from the exploration and exploration in specialized texts, the views of financial experts (including university professors and market experts) in order to understand their views and identify the dimensions, components, indexes and factors determining the financial flexibility of the Corporates were obtained through a questionnaire. In the second step, after referring to the model, the correlation method as one of the subsections of the descriptive research methodology for measuring the components of cash holdings, debt capacity, and capital market measure of Tehran Securities Exchange Corporates with the actual and historical information of financial statements and information Corporate stock trading (through multivariate regression tests and confirmatory factor analysis) The results of the measurement of the three components indicate that the amount of cash holdings, the size of the debt capability, and the relatively downward trend of the size of the capital market (stock liquidity) of the Tehran Securities Exchange corporations during the years 1380 to 1394, are. Measuring the dual dimension of financial flexibility also implies the use of internal financial flexibility and the non-use of external financial flexibility. Which can be explained by Trade off Theory, Pecking Order Theory and of asymmetric information Theory.

In this study, different approaches including addition of disulfide bridges, saturation of surface charges, and decrease of segmental flexibility have been used to increase thermostability of firefly luciferase. A disulfide bridge is introduced into Photinus pyralis firefly luciferase to make two separate mutant enzymes. One of the designed mutant (A103C/S121C) showed remarkable thermal stability, its specific activity decreased, whereas the A296C/A326C mutant showed tremendous thermal stability and 7.3-fold increase of specific activity. Analysis of enzyme according to residues B-factors shows that its C-terminal is much more flexible than its N-terminal. Two mutations in the most flexible region of luciferase were designed. Analysis shows that D476N mutation doesn' t have any significant effect but D474K mutation destabilized protein. On the other hand, flexibility analysis using dynamic quenching and limited proteolysis demonstrates that D474K mutation became more flexible than wild type. Protein engineering studies have shown that thermostable proteins have a higher frequency of Arg, especially in exposed states. To further elucidate the arginine saturation effects on stability of firefly luciferase, some of hydrophobic solvent-exposed residues in luciferase are changed to arginine. All of these residues are located at the external loops of L. turkestanicus luciferase.Introduction of double mutation (-Q35R/I232R) and triple mutation (- Q35R/I232R/I182R) were reserved specific activity of enzyme while its stability was enlarged and its flexibility was declined. Structural and functional properties of the mutants were investigated using different spectroscopic methods. It seems a clear relationship between stability and segmental flexibility in firefly luciferase controls its activity under different conditions.
